    About a year and a half ago I started a project which i thought would have been fun. As some of you may know i bought a 87 toyota truck with a chevy 350 v8 in it.

    The truck itself is in excellent shape, Ive painted it and kept everything else working. I've run into some mechanical issues where I'm not quite sure what the issue is.

    My main problem here is that I need to sell it. I'm in college, Lost my job, and as of right now I'm living off my savings to make sure I can keep my 2006 tacoma.

    Before I had the issues I had the truck listed at $5500. Since then i found the running issue and lowered it to $4000.

    My problem is that i had very little interest even when it was running. I have the Mechanical skills and sorta the area to replace the motor if that's the issue. but I feel that even if I invest the money to make it run again I still wont be able to get anywhere near what I have invested in this truck.

    What I'm asking of the forum is to give me suggestions as to what to do with this truck.

    Should I put money into it and hope that someone will want a Modded truck?

    Can I even put the original motor back in it? ( I would have to buy a new motor/transmission/transfer case ) and still hope the mounts would work.

    should I try to part it out? its a 87 with only 55k miles on the body.

    I dont want to lower the price so much that im making a HUGE loss more than I already am with it. This truck has amazing potential and its a shame that a completely rusted out toyota can sell better than this amazing body one.

    Well, you did ask for opinions. It's a modified rig and it doesn't run. I wouldn't hold out much hope for a quick sale or getting your asking price. We don't usually make any money on projects...it's a money pit from day one. That being said, you think the engine is shot? Even here a 350 can be found pretty cheap. I'd think you'd at least want it running before the sale. Good Luck with whatever you decide. Me? I'd get it running, throw a solid axle under the front and giver'ell!
